By the first half of the 15th century, the … Web21 sep. 2024 · While Medici: The Magnificent has Venus and Mars destroyed in the finale of the first part of the series, the painting actually still exists and is owned by the National Gallery of London. It was painted around 1485, which was after the deaths of Vespucci in 1476 and Giuliano in 1478. They died exactly two years apart from one another to the day.

Elite women of sixteenth-century France took advantage of their positions to become influential art patrons and collectors. Catherine de’ Medici (1519-1589) was one such woman.
